Zoom has built-in advanced tools that can improve your audio playback. Though they are built to reduce background noise in essence and boost audio, they sometimes can cause low audio or similar sound issues in Zoom. Step 1: Run Zoom to enter its main interface and then click on the Settings icon.
Step 2: Click the Audio option in the left pane of the Setting window. Step 3: Move to the right side of the window and choose the microphone that you are using now from the Microphone drop-down menu. Step 4: Choose the Automatically join audio by computer when joining a meeting option.
Then click on the Advanced button at the bottom right corner of the window. Finally, set the status of Echo cancellation to Auto. Download Partition Wizard. Read More.

Head back to the meeting window and click the Turn on Original Sound button at the top-right corner. If you have multiple audio devices connected to your computer, click the drop-down icon next to the option and select your preferred microphone. Launch the Windows Settings app and go to Privacy. Navigate to the App permissions section on the left sidebar and select Microphone.
You need to enable two important permissions on this page for any microphone built-in or external to work with Zoom on your computer. First, toggle on the Allow apps to access your microphone option. Scroll further down the page and also toggle on Allow desktop apps to access your microphone. On the left sidebar, click Microphone and make sure Zoom or zoom.
